ustedes
pronounCEFR A1High frequency
What does “ustedes” mean in English?
you all / you plural
Example sentences
¿Ustedes viven aquí?
Do you all live here?
Ustedes son estudiantes.
You all are students.
How to use it
Ustedes means plural 'you' / 'you all'. In Latin America it is the normal plural you. In Spain it is also understood and used formally; informal Spain often uses vosotros/vosotras.
